So it has something to do with FreshTinyIoC. I just don't get why this works when running off VS 2019 in debug mode off my phone.
Any ideas would be greatly appreciated.
The issue is quite simple actually you have set linking to SDK & User Assemblies which means it is linking everything, your models and every other class, anything that does not have a reference will be collected and removed for better understanding you can check my blog which has an entire section on how to work with Linking:
https://heartbeat.fritz.ai/reducing-the-app-size-in-xamarin-deep-dive-7ddc9cb12688
As of now, I would suggest you can check Link SDK Assemblies for now and then you can Link everything as that takes a little time

Xamarin.Forms - MONO_GC_PARAMS=bridge-implementation=old - how to tell if it's working on Windows?

I'm seeing this cryptic exception that's been documented on bugzilla.xamarin.com periodically. Most of the posts suggest you can suppress the error by changing the bridge implementation to the Old version instead of Tarjan by setting an environment variable:
MONO_GC_PARAMS=bridge-implementation=old
I set the variable, but I don't see anything in my logcat or build output to indicate it's using one bridge or the other, and I'm still getting the exception. Is there a way to tell which implementation is being used?

The current suggestion is using new rather than old when changing the default GC Bridge away from tarjan. You may have been told to use the "old" default which was technically new before changing to tarjan in Mono 4.6:
http://www.mono-project.com/docs/about-mono/releases/4.6.0/#new-default-gc-bridge-processor-on-android
You can see if this is being picked up by checking the Diagnostic Build Output of your project.
https://developer.xamarin.com/guides/android/troubleshooting/troubleshooting/#Diagnostic_MSBuild_Output
You would then look to ensure the configuration file is picked up with the respective arguments.
